Functionality and Uses

Sand timers serve a variety of purposes, from practical applications to creative and recreational uses. Here are some of the most common uses for sand timers:

  • Time Management: Sand timers are a great tool for managing time during meetings, study sessions, or work breaks. They can help you stay focused and on track without the need for a clock or timer.

  • Relaxation and Meditation: The soothing sound of sand flowing through a timer can be a calming presence during meditation or relaxation exercises.

  • Artistic Projects: Sand timers can be used as a unique element in art installations or photography projects, adding a sense of movement and time to your work.

  • Cooking and Baking: Sand timers are a useful tool for measuring the passage of time during cooking and baking, ensuring that your dishes are perfectly timed.

  • Teaching and Learning: Sand timers can be used in educational settings to help students understand the concept of time and to keep them engaged during lessons.
